Why Container Homes Are Gaining Popularity

Cost-Effective Housing Solutions
Traditional home construction can be expensive and time-consuming. Repurposed containers offer a cost-effective solution that reduces material and labor expenses. Families and individuals can access quality living spaces without the high price tag associated with conventional buildings.

Sustainable and Eco-Friendly Living
Sustainability is a key factor in housing choices today. Using shipping containers reduces construction waste and supports environmentally conscious living. Many homeowners appreciate the opportunity to embrace eco-friendly practices without compromising on comfort or style.

Quick Construction and Flexibility
Container homes can be built more quickly than traditional houses, thanks to prefabricated designs and modular construction methods. This speed makes them ideal for urban areas with high housing demand or for individuals seeking a fast move-in solution.

Design Flexibility: From Minimalist to Modern Luxury

Container homes are no longer limited to industrial-style boxes. Modern designs allow homeowners to create spaces that are functional, comfortable, and visually appealing. Multiple containers can be combined to form multi-level layouts or expanded to accommodate additional rooms.

From compact studios to spacious multi-bedroom homes, a Converted Container House can be tailored to meet diverse needs. Architects often incorporate large windows, open floor plans, and modern finishes, resulting in homes that are both aesthetically pleasing and practical.

Adapting Container Homes to Urban Living

In densely populated cities, land is often limited, and housing costs are high. Container homes provide an efficient way to utilize available space without sacrificing quality of life. They can fit smaller plots while offering modern amenities, making them a viable alternative for families, professionals, and even small businesses seeking adaptable housing solutions.

Urban residents are increasingly attracted to these homes because they combine affordability, mobility, and the possibility of customized layouts. Communities with container homes can also include shared amenities, creating social and functional spaces for residents.

Sustainability Benefits of Container Homes

Sustainability is becoming a critical factor in housing choices worldwide. Container homes address this need by repurposing materials that would otherwise go to waste. Additionally, many designs incorporate energy-efficient insulation, solar panels, and water-saving systems, further reducing environmental impact.

Residents can enjoy modern comforts while contributing to ecological preservation. The flexibility to integrate renewable energy solutions also aligns with broader green initiatives in urban development, demonstrating that a Converted Container House can support both lifestyle and environmental goals.

Common Misconceptions

Despite their growing popularity, container homes are sometimes misunderstood:

Uncomfortable Living: Proper insulation, ventilation, and design ensure that container homes are just as comfortable as conventional houses.

Temporary Solution: High-quality construction can make container homes durable for decades.

Limited Design Options: Modern architecture allows container homes to be highly customizable, from single-unit dwellings to complex multi-container layouts.

Educating potential homeowners about these realities helps promote container-based housing as a credible and long-term option.
